Latest Patents
Aurilio's latest patents include two groundbreaking processes for regasifying fluids and generating electrical energy. The first patent, titled "Recompressed transcritical cycle with vaporization in cryogenic or low-temperature applications," outlines a comprehensive method that involves multiple steps, including pumping, heating, expanding in a turbine, and cooling. This process aims to optimize the generation of electrical energy from operating fluids. The second patent, "Recompressed transcritical cycle with post-expanding in cryogenic or low-temperature applications," further refines the energy production process by incorporating high-pressure pumping and mechanical energy production, showcasing Aurilio's commitment to advancing energy technologies.
